The e+-e- annihilation line and the cosmic X-ray background

Description
The possibility that the processes responsible for the Cosmic X-ray Background (CXB) would also produce an e--e+ annihilation feature is examined. Under the assumption that these processes are thermal, the absence of a strong e--e+ annihilation feature places constraints on the compactness (L/R ratio) of these sources. Observations favour sources of small compactness ratio. (Auth.)
